1/2 cup is 75g, so you can use measuring cups/spoons that are fractions thereof to measure smaller amounts. Alternatively, you can buy a cheap lab scale and measure more accurately.

I know I've seen it both ways 1/2 cup being 75g and 2/3 cup being 75g. Swolecat has contacted companies that have it labelled wrong. I don't know why I've never done this to verify before, but I just weighed 1/2 cup of dextrose, and it's 77g. A digital lab scale is pretty cheap and makes measuring much easier....I use it for all sorts of things...weighing food, creatine, glutamine, dextrose.....you name it....good investment.
